Big Week for Michael

Next week a frustrated soap-opera character will have the dubious distinction of turning up in two lathery melodramas at the same time. His script name is Michael West (played by Actor Joe Julian), gimpy-legged lover of Big Sister, a radio do-gooder of note. So attractive did Lever Bros. (Lux, Rinso, Swan) find Mike, whose love for Big Sister is not reciprocated save in a highly platonic way, that they decided to give him a program of his own, tentatively entitled Bright Horizon; The Story of Michael West.

The new program will concern itself chiefly with Mike's efforts to rehabilitate the erring brother of Carol, a girl of good family for whom he has a spiritual admiration. Michael will also remain in Big Sister's show while starring in his own until he can be gracefully written out. Meanwhile Big Sister (Actress Alice Frost) will participate in a couple of Michael's programs, more or less to show him around.
